Comprised of recommendations from a stakeholder group led by the Board of Water and Soil Resources (BWSR) and the Department of Natural Resources (DNR), this bill is a package of statute changes designed to improve the public value benefits resulting from the Wetland Conservation Act. Among its many initiatives, the bill includes:
- Stakeholder coordination in a new wetland working group to provide an ongoing process for developing improvements to the Wetland Conservation Act.
- Changes that include allowing counties to offer reduced property taxes to landowners for protecting wetlands on their property.
- Establishment of an interagency “rapid response team” to further wetland replacement.
- A report to the legislature from BWSR on the proposals to implement high priority areas for wetland replacement, in lieu fee replacement, wetland replacement siting, and actions eligible for credit.
